Lessons from Asia for a Multi-Year Pandemic

Dr. Khor Swee Kheng, Visiting Fellow, Institute of Strategic and International Studies  Instructions and QR code for SafeEntry contact tracing is displayed amid coronavirus at a Sejong Culture Center ahead of musical Mozart on July 21, 2020 in Seoul, South Korea. (Chung Sung-Jun/Getty Images) December 21st, 2020 Recent good news about COVID-19 vaccines must be taken with a dose of caution, as the vaccines’ long-term effectiveness, manufacturing, financing, and logistics remain daunting challenges. Therefore, as the world settles into a multi-year pandemic, non-pharmaceutical interventions will remain a crucial part of the pandemic response. As Asia has generally fared better than other regions in humanity’s first year with COVID-19, what lessons from Asian countries should we consider for global public health?

Cornwall Council planning delay leads to compensation

Cornwall Council, County Hall, Truro (Image: Richard Whitehouse/LDRS) Cornwall Council has apologised and paid £200 compensation to a resident who was left waiting for months to resolve a planning dispute. The Local Government and Social Care Ombudsman said it had upheld the complaint which was brought against the council earlier this year. It found that the council had been at fault for a delay in providing updates on a planning enforcement complaint that the resident, known only as Mrs B, had brought against her neighbour’s business. The ombudsman also found the council at fault for its communication approach “which has meant Mrs B received no updates on progress or responses to her complaints about the council’s handling”.
